KCNQ2 Encephalopathy Showing a Distinct Ictal Amplitude- Integrated Electroencephalographic Pattern
Naeun Kwak,Yun Jeong Lee,김동섭,Su-Kyeong Hwang,권순학,Eun Joo Lee 대한신생아학회 2020 Neonatal medicine Vol.27 No.4
KCNQ2 mutations induce a neonatal-onset epileptic encephalopathy of widely varying severity, ranging from benign familial neonatal epilepsy to severe refractory epileptic encephalopathy. Refractory seizures with KCNQ2 mutations have a positive response to sodium-channel blockers. Recently, a distinctive ictal pattern has been reported during amplitude-integrated electroencephalographic (aEEG) monitoring in infants with KCNQ2 encephalopathy. Herein, we describe a case of KCNQ2 encephalopathy with this distinctive ictal aEEG pattern, which was confirmed using conventional electroencephalography (EEG). A 3-day-old female infant presented with neonatal seizures accompanied by cyanosis and desaturation. Her seizure semiology was tonic and focal clonic. Her ictal aEEG demonstrated a sudden rise in amplitude followed by a suppressed background pattern. This pattern was also confirmed on conventional EEG. Her seizures were refractory despite the administration of multiple conventional antiepileptic drugs. Finally, c.794C>T; p. (Ala265Val) mutation was observed in the KCNQ2 gene on genetic testing, and she was diagnosed with KCNQ2 encephalopathy. Identifying this distinctive ictal pattern on aEEG monitoring facilitates the early detection of KCNQ2 encephalopathy and timely targeted treatment in patients with refractory seizures.
Comparison of sensorless dimming control based on building modeling and solar power generation
Lee, Naeun,Kim, Jonghun,Jang, Cheolyong,Sung, Yoondong,Jeong, Hakgeun Elsevier 2015 ENERGY Vol.81 No.-
<P><B>Abstract</B></P> <P>Artificial lighting in office buildings accounts for about 30% of the total building energy consumption. Lighting energy is important to reduce building energy consumption since artificial lighting typically has a relatively large energy conversion factor. Therefore, previous studies have proposed a dimming control using daylight. When applied dimming control, method based on building modeling does not need illuminance sensors. Thus, it can be applied to existing buildings that do not have illuminance sensors. However, this method does not accurately reflect real-time weather conditions. On the other hand, solar power generation from a PV (photovoltaic) panel reflects real-time weather conditions. The PV panel as the sensor improves the accuracy of dimming control by reflecting disturbance. Therefore, we compared and analyzed two types of sensorless dimming controls: those based on the building modeling and those that based on solar power generation using PV panels.</P> <P>In terms of energy savings, we found that a dimming control based on building modeling is more effective than that based on solar power generation by about 6%. This paper presents the stages of the wooden coffin accessories of the large stone chamber tombs in the Yeongsan River Basin based on an examination and comparison of those wooden coffin accessories. In addition, through a comparison with examples from of the Baekje capital during the Ungjin period, the way in which the meaning of the wooden coffin accessories changed was observed. In the Ungjin period tombs of the Yeongsan River basin, wooden coffin accessories of different types were excavated, and it is believed that two to three coffins were generally used. The combination of wooden coffin accessories can be divided into four stages: the first stage is when headless nails were used; the second stage is when square-headed nails were used; the third stage is when circular coffin rings and round-headed nails were used; the fourth stage is when square coffin rings were added and round-headed nails continued to be used. It is estimated that the first stage is at the late of the 5th century, the second stage is early of the 6th century, the third and fourth stage is at the mid-6th century. The wooden coffin accessories excavated from Ungjin tombs in the Yeongsan River Basin differ in distribution pattern, and in the first half of the Ungjin period, such artifacts were identified in Dasi, Naju, and it is estimated that this area was related to Baekje from early on. In the late Ungjin period, the wooden coffins of the Baekje royal class tombs appear in the northern tombs of the Yeongsan River Basin and subsequently change in a similar manner. It is estimated that the groups that constructed the tombs in this region emerged through various roles, while maintaining a close relationship with the capital of Baekje. In addition, it is noteworthy that in the southwestern region of Naju in the early Sabi period, a pattern of wooden accessory combinations similar to that of the Baekje capital appeared. The use of wooden coffins was an important part of the burial ritual of ancient tombs, and it can be estimated, through the wooden coffin accessories, that almost the same burial rituals as that of the capital of Baekje were performed.
